How to make dippy eggs and soldiers
Bring a small pan of water to a gentle boil. Lower large eggs in with a spoon so they do not crack. Set a timer for 5 minutes for a classic runny yolk (4½ if you follow Ramsay's soft set, 6 if you want slightly thicker).
While eggs cook, toast thick-cut white, wheat, or sourdough. Butter while hot, then cut into finger strips about half an inch to an inch wide. Those are your soldiers.
Lift eggs into egg cups. Tap around the top with a spoon or knife, remove the lid, season the yolk with salt and pepper, and film the first soldier dipping into the gold.

Common questions
- What are soft boiled eggs with soldiers?
- A soft-boiled egg served in the shell in an egg cup, topped so the yolk stays runny, with buttered toast cut into strips for dipping. The strips are called soldiers. On TikTok it shows up as cook-with-me breakfast clips, not one shared sound.
- How long do you boil the eggs?
- Most viral clips land between 4½ and 6 minutes after the eggs go into boiling or simmering water. Five minutes is the common middle for a liquid yolk with set whites. Size and fridge-cold vs room-temp eggs shift the window by about 30 seconds.

- Do I need egg cups?
- Cups keep the shell upright for dipping and match the classic look. Without cups, you can nest the egg in a small napkin ring or shot glass, but the TikTok thumbnail almost always uses a real egg cup.
- What bread works best for soldiers?
- Thick white, wheat, or sourdough that stays firm after buttering. Thin sandwich slices go floppy in the yolk. Cut strips narrow enough to fit the opening without snapping.
